Designer: User Experience Intern 2026



Job description

**Introduction**
About the Team

As IBM Z Designers, you are part of a community of innovators, creators, and design thinkers.

Our systems power the world’s most important industries, and our clients are the architects of the future.

Transforming our business to deliver on that future is at the heart of our Design mission.

Role Description:

As an IBM Z Designer, your focus will be on meeting individual and team objectives, learning your craft, contributing to the design of a product and learning about IBM and IBM Design practices.

Generally, your efforts will be concentrated around a single product in your business area, with guidance and feedback from a more senior designer or design leader.

You will also contribute to the design community by supporting community activities, sharing, learning or maintaining a part of the community operation.

As designers, we focus on ensuring the experiences we create meet the needs of our customers and end users and strive for design excellence in our work.

You will apply a user-centered perspective to your design work and advocate for the customer / end user in all interactions with your teammates and colleagues.

At times you may also engage with customers or other users of the product in the design process.
**Your role and responsibilities**
Job Duties:

Key/Strategic Responsibilities

• Grow domain knowledge by learning the value proposition of your product, its market

position, the basics of its technologies and how it’s used by our customers.

• Develop enough domain fluency to contribute ideas that differentiate the solution in the

market.

• Attend and participate in design and product-oriented activities, such as stand-ups,

Town Halls, product demos or design critiques.

• Develop the ability to find and apply relevant industry references/trends.

• Identify improvement opportunities at the individual product level

Cross-Functional Responsibilities

• Attend client / sponsor user sessions; establish your own client relationships.

• Contribute to the design of a product by advocating for the user experience and value.

• Learn about the org structure and key stakeholders of your PM and dev teams

• Seek and provide feedback on outcomes to your entire team.

• Support advocacy of design thinking across the team.

• Communicate with other designers and your 3iab team about your project status.

• Attend and participate in design reviews and playbacks to share experience design and

related artifacts.

• Understand how your work fits into the department mission, strategy, and vision.

Functional Responsibilities

• Contribute towards delivery of project needs, such as research insights or user

experience deliverables, in alignment with timeline and roadmap milestones.

• Participate in concept ideation informed by an understanding of users, clients, and their

desired outcomes.

• Adapt work and processes according to guidance and direction from design leads.

• Strengthen your craft skills in your discipline through learning, mentorship, and

producing.

• Expand competencies across t-shape to better contribute to personal and team

outcomes.

• Acquire Enterprise Design Thinking fluency and infuse practices into work.

• Develop foundational knowledge in the technologies needed for your product/org, such

as AI.

• Develop entry-level knowledge of IBM Experience Standards.

• Participate in internal and external design community activities.

• Familiarity with accessibility guidelines and principles (e.g., WCAG)

Additional Discipline Specific Responsibilities:

Research

Support user research activities and customer interactions.

Contribute to research sessions/planning.

Design research plans (with oversight).

Lead research sessions.

Demonstrate the ability to ask effective questions.

Put customers and stakeholders at ease during session.

Synthesize research

Share and communicate research findings

Support storytelling around an on-going narrative leads will build for a hill

UX

Collaborate with research to understand core problems being solved in design.

Execute and expand on established UX flows.

Create wireframes, user flows and prototypes with oversight from design lead.

Adjust designs based on formal and informal feedback

Create low and high-fidelity designs from approved concepts.

Support production of assets for use during usability testing.

Actively participate in EDT sessions.

  • Interview Tips for Designer: User Experience Intern 2026 Job Success
    IBM interview tips for Designer: User Experience Intern 2026

    Here are some tips to help you prepare for and ace your job interview:

    Before the Interview:
    • Research: Learn about the IBM's mission, values, products, and the specific job requirements and get further information about
    • Other Openings
    • Practice: Prepare answers to common interview questions and rehearse using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to showcase your skills and experiences.
    • Dress Professionally: Choose attire appropriate for the company culture.
    • Prepare Questions: Show your interest by having thoughtful questions for the interviewer.
    • Plan Your Commute: Allow ample time to arrive on time and avoid feeling rushed.
    During the Interview:
    • Be Punctual: Arrive on time to demonstrate professionalism and respect.
    • Make a Great First Impression: Greet the interviewer with a handshake, smile, and eye contact.
    • Confidence and Enthusiasm: Project a positive attitude and show your genuine interest in the opportunity.
    • Answer Thoughtfully: Listen carefully, take a moment to formulate clear and concise responses. Highlight relevant skills and experiences using the STAR method.
    • Ask Prepared Questions: Demonstrate curiosity and engagement with the role and company.
    • Follow Up: Send a thank-you email to the interviewer within 24 hours.
    Additional Tips:
    • Be Yourself: Let your personality shine through while maintaining professionalism.
    • Be Honest: Don't exaggerate your skills or experience.
    • Be Positive: Focus on your strengths and accomplishments.
    • Body Language: Maintain good posture, avoid fidgeting, and make eye contact.
    • Turn Off Phone: Avoid distractions during the interview.
